How courts have described this case

Verbatim parenthetical descriptions written by other courts when citing this decision. Ranked by citation-network relevance.

  • holding that discriminatory views of one member of five-member village council cannot be imputed to the entire council
  • recognizing the \well-established principle that the States have 'undisputed power to set the level of benefits and the standard of need' for their AFDC programs\ (quoting King v. Smith, 392 U.S. at 334)
  • finding no procedural error in an appeals court’s direction of an entry of judgment enjoining a state’s operation of a program that the state had discontinued long before
  • portions of 42 U.S.C. § 602 which only apply to AFDC indicated by a specific reference
  • deference given to interpretation of statute by agencies charged with its execution
  • state emergency assistance program consistent with SSA
